You know I agree with the guy, whats happening in Japan can not be representative in Europe and North America for a couple reasons:

1.Japan has a population of over 127 million people. While North America and Europe have a combined population of over a billion people.

2.Japan has a totally different market when compared to North America or Europe.

3. The 3DS has over 4 million usits sold in US, so a majority of the sales come from North America. Who is to say the Vita won't succeed in North America/Europe

Statistically speaking the Vita could do even better in North America and Europe then in Japan but thats just statistics alone sometimes its right and sometimes its not.

You have to consider that 3DS did have a HUGE price cut, which most likely contributed to sales. And from what I heard, yes, there were 4 million sales of 3DS in the US, but that's after the 4 million sales of 3DS in Japan. The majority of sales aren't from the US, I believe. Either way, it's still cheaper than its competitor, the Vita. A Vita will cost at least $270 at launch, taking into account people will buy memory cards and already have games on PSN. I don't see how you can expect not to see a problem with other countries' launches. I'm gonna say that Western launches will have similar results. The 3DS had similar problems for their launches. I don't see Vita doing any different, at this rate anyway.
